mirror of
https://github.com/dart-lang/sdk
synced 2024-09-16 03:17:55 +00:00
5e49ea5ad8
Fix the service type `TypeParameters` to recognize it is a heap object. Exhaustively test that the service client libraries can handle inflating all types produced by the VM. Compare vm/cc/PrintJSON, which exhaustively tests the VM can generate any type. TEST=ci Bug: https://github.com/dart-lang/sdk/issues/52893 Change-Id: Id1f080656ef6e999e69f2ebb5b9961fa3b461e4a Reviewed-on: https://dart-review.googlesource.com/c/sdk/+/316862 Reviewed-by: Ben Konyi <bkonyi@google.com> Commit-Queue: Ryan Macnak <rmacnak@google.com>
31 lines
772 B
YAML
31 lines
772 B
YAML
name: vm_service
|
|
version: 11.9.0
|
|
description: >-
|
|
A library to communicate with a service implementing the Dart VM
|
|
service protocol.
|
|
|
|
repository: https://github.com/dart-lang/sdk/tree/main/pkg/vm_service
|
|
|
|
environment:
|
|
sdk: '>=2.19.0 <4.0.0'
|
|
|
|
# We use 'any' version constraints here as we get our package versions from
|
|
# the dart-lang/sdk repo's DEPS file. Note that this is a special case; the
|
|
# best practice for packages is to specify their compatible version ranges.
|
|
# See also https://dart.dev/tools/pub/dependencies.
|
|
dev_dependencies:
|
|
async: any
|
|
expect: any
|
|
lints: any
|
|
markdown: any
|
|
mockito: any
|
|
path: any
|
|
pub_semver: any
|
|
test_package: any
|
|
test: any
|
|
vm_service_protos: any
|
|
|
|
dependency_overrides:
|
|
test_package:
|
|
path: 'test/test_package'
|